Output 26b4cca43961d85b857a6406599f121d8c8f71762d4833d516f355323e6be1bf:2

value
378778384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540ab14358020369280f1ade62b4d85f4584527b OP_EQUAL
address
MFZXoU49inhR91k7LFPcWWduDWNLY3jqc1
transaction
26b4cca43961d85b857a6406599f121d8c8f71762d4833d516f355323e6be1bf
spent
true